WebJul 28, 2024 · The standard test conditions for OTR testing are 73°F (23°C) and 0% RH and the end result values are expressed in cc/100in2/24hr in US standard and cc/m2/24hr in metric unit. As an industry standard, a material or a package is considered to be a high oxygen barrier package when its OTR is less than 1 cc/100in2/24hr or 15.5 cc/m2/24hr. Polyethylene absorbs almost no water; the gas and water vapour permeability (only polar gases) is lower than for most plastics. Oxygen, carbon dioxide and flavorings, on the other hand, can pass it easily. PE can become brittle when exposed to sunlight, carbon black is usually used as a UV stabilizer.
